A number of Tottenham fans have taken to Twitter to respond to the comments that Michel Vorm made – that have been reported by the Daily Mail – regarding his decision to stay at Tottenham this summer as the club took up the option on his deal.

Vorm has spent four seasons on Spurs’ books. Despite establishing himself as one of the more impressive Premier League stoppers during his time with Swansea, he has spent that entire time with Tottenham as Hugo Lloris’ understudy.

The 34-year-old has barely reached double figures for league appearances, and has played less than 50 games in all competitions since arriving. So many would have been forgiven for expecting The Netherlands international to depart this summer when his contract expired.

However, Vorm insisted that he felt that he had little reason to leave the club during this window given the relationship he has with the club and the key figures associated with Spurs.

“I am still very happy here. I didn’t have other options. Maybe I would if we looked for it,” he said, as reported by the Mail.

“It might be difficult to understand on the outside but I feel very appreciated here.

“I’ve been here from the start with Pochettino and the staff. I’ve really seen us evolve to where we are now. With the new stadium coming up it’s such a joy to be here. You look at your family as well. It depends also on the type of goalkeeper I am.”

In response, a number of Tottenham fans have lauded Vorm for the attitude that he shows. There are some who feel that he should have left in the summer or not seen the option in his contract taken up by the club, but the majority appear to be extremely impressed by his comments.
